News and Notes for Saturday, July 26th, 2027

The Guardians and Royals will play a doubleheader today at 2:40PM and 7:15PM EDT, after yesterday’s rainout.

So far, probable starters are still listed as Gavin Williams and Tanner Bibee. I wonder what that means for next week, as the Guardians don’t have an off-day until Thursday, so one of these guys would be due to start Wednesday on only three days rest.

In continued trade deadline activity, the Yankees traded for Ryan McMahon from the Rockies, and the Mets landed Gregory Soto from the Orioles.

Nick Kurtz went 6 for 6 with four home runs in a historic performance thrashing the Astros. Time for everyone who believed the Guardians, Reds and Rockies should have drafted Kurtz to take their victory laps. In all seriousness, he looks great. Hopefully Travis Bazzana will also look great, someday. We all know Kurtz would still be in Columbus for Cleveland.
